    Irene T.

    Delicious and cheap roti! We got the curry goat roti, jerk chicken roti and a spicy beef patty. Their rotis are absolutely incredible. Super huge, filling and only $8.99! Their patty was super underwhelming. The crust was very oily/butter and soggy as if they just nuked the patty. The filling was barely there! Was quite disappointed with it. Nonetheless, I'd come back for the roti. They close at 6pm so make sure you get in early!

    Denise M.

    It was my first time trying out this family run restaurant and I was impressed with the hospitality and food. I would consider this more of a take out place as there was only one small area to sit and eat. The young man at the front was very helpful and knowledgeable about the menu. I decided on the rice with jerk chicken and salad as I was told this was one of their popular meals. My order came to about $10.80 and I received a free double for checking in. The double was flavourful and filling. The dough was a little more oily then im used to but the flavour made up for it. The jerk chicken was a little spicy but not overpowering. The chicken was juicy and the rice was cooked perfectly. The jerk sauce mixed into the rice makes it even better. The portions were a good size for lunch.
